Nihal is a name of Arabic, Turkish, Indian, and Hindi origin. It is a unisex name that can be given to both boys and girls. Currently, Nihal is ranked #3596 (boy) and #13035 (girl) in popularity in the United States and is classified as a common (boy) and rare (girl) name.
